    Abstract: A light-emitting diode (LED) includes a first semiconductor layer, an active layer, and a second semiconductor layer that are sequentially stacked, and includes a first electrode pad, a second electrode pad and a third electrode pad disposed on the second semiconductor layer in a direction from a corner of the second semiconductor layer to an opposite corner of the second semiconductor layer. An LED includes a first electrode pad disposed at a center of the LED and in contact with a P-type semiconductor layer and a second electrode pad in contact with an N-type semiconductor layer, wherein the second electrode pad is disposed a maximum distance away from the first electrode pad on the same surface.

    Abstract: Provided is a light-emitting device including a substrate, a light-emitting pattern provided on the substrate, a first reflection film provided between the light-emitting pattern and the substrate, a second reflection film provided on a side surface of the light-emitting pattern, and a passivation film provided between the light-emitting pattern and the second reflection film, wherein the second reflection film is electrically connected to the light-emitting pattern, and a portion of light generated from the light-emitting pattern is emitted through an upper surface of the light-emitting pattern after being reflected by at least one of the first reflection film and the second reflection film.

    Abstract: A high-resolution display device is provided. The high-resolution display device includes a light-emitting layer including a first semiconductor layer, an active layer, and a second semiconductor layer, a plurality of transparent electrodes respectively formed on the second semiconductor layer in sub-pixel regions, a first electrode connected to the first semiconductor layer, a plurality of second electrodes connected to the plurality of transparent electrodes, a color-converting layer arranged over the light-emitting layer and configured to emit light of a predetermined color based on light generated by the light-emitting layer, which are sequentially stacked on a substrate including a plurality of sub-pixel regions. One or more ion injection regions corresponding to current injection regions corresponding to the plurality of the sub-pixel regions is formed in the second semiconductor layer.
